We're hiring our next Head of Growth at Quenzy!
We're building one of the fastest-growing better-for-you soda brands, and we're looking for someone who loves building brands and driving growth from the ground up. 📍 Bengaluru based preferred What you'll do: >Own Quenzy's overall growth strategy across online and offline channels. >Grow our presence across Amazon, quick commerce, retail, and other distribution channels. >Build and expand our B2B business by identifying, reaching out to, and onboarding new clients. >Manage relationships with cafés, restaurants, offices, and corporate partners to drive repeat business. >Develop ne partnerships and GTM opportunities. >Work closely with me on strategy, partnerships, and execution. Who we're looking for: >1-2 years of experience in Growth, Business Development, Sales, Marketing, or GTM at a consumer startup or FMCG brand. >Experience building B2B partnerships and managing key accounts is a big plus. >A self-starter who takes ownership and gets things done. >Strong communication and relationship-building skills. >Comfortable working in a fast-paced startup environment.
